Transaction 7db59ccab34a0993297686cc7938bbc550f6e8e56060590b8bb1399f00ad0e00
1 Input
1 Output
-
7db59ccab34a0993297686cc7938bbc550f6e8e56060590b8bb1399f00ad0e00:0
- value
- 168688
- script pubkey
- OP_0 OP_PUSHBYTES_32 c9573164c4060367b68c6f0af313365eeeafe2f718c6a5e891fa73c0351ce431
- address
- bc1qe9tnzexyqcpk0d5vdu90xyektmh2lchhrrr2t6y3lfeuqdguuscsztjvtm